Certain opioid medications such as methadone and more buprenorphine are commonly used to treat dependency and dependence on other opioids such as heroin, morphine or oxycodone. Methadone and buprenorphine are maintenance therapies meant to lower yearnings for opiates, consequently reducing controlled substance usage, and the dangers associated with it, such as disease, arrest, imprisonment, and death, in line with the philosophy of damage decrease.
All readily available research studies collected in the 2005 Australian National Assessment of Pharmacotherapies for Opioid Dependence recommend that upkeep treatment is more effective, with really high rates (79100%) of relapse within 3 months of cleansing from levo-- acetylmethadol (LAAM), buprenorphine, and methadone. According to the National Institute on Drug Abuse (NIDA), patients stabilized on sufficient, continual doses of methadone or buprenorphine can keep their tasks, prevent crime and violence, and reduce their direct exposure to HIV and Liver Disease C by stopping or lowering injection substance abuse and drug-related high danger sexual habits.

Disulfiram (also called Antabuse) produces an extremely undesirable reaction when drinking alcohol that consists of flushing, queasiness and palpitations. It is more effective for patients with high inspiration and some addicts utilize it only for high-risk circumstances. Clients who wish to continue drinking or might be most likely to relapse ought to not take disulfiram as it can result in the disulfiram-alcohol response pointed out formerly, which is very major and can even be deadly.

The definition of healing remains divided and subjective in drug rehab, as there are no set requirements for measuring recovery. The Betty Ford Institute specified healing as achieving complete abstinence in addition to individual well-being while other studies have thought about "near abstaining" as a definition. The large range of significances has made complex the procedure of picking rehabilitation programs.

Traditional addiction treatment is based mainly on therapy. Counselors help individuals with identifying habits and problems associated with their dependency. It can be done on a private basis, but it's more typical to discover it in a group setting and can include crisis therapy, weekly or everyday therapy, and drop-in counseling supports.
It's extremely common to see them likewise work with relative who are affected by the dependencies of the person, or in a neighborhood to avoid addiction and inform the public. Counselors ought to have the ability to recognize how dependency affects the whole person and those around him or her. Therapy is likewise associated with "Intervention"; a procedure in which the addict's family and loved ones request assistance from a professional to get an individual into drug treatment.
